California Native American Celebration    

September through November    

Various Locations (see link below) 
 

The University of California, San Diego's sixth annual California Native American Day celebrations have been expanded with various events highlighting the past, present and future identities of San Diego's indigenous cultures. California Native American Day was established as an official state holiday in 1998 and is recognized on the fourth Friday of every September. However, at UC San Diego the holiday has been expanded throughout fall quarter and for the first year ever, California Native American Day will be celebrated throughout the 2011-2012 academic year. The Coming Out Groupcoming out group  

Tuesdays | 5-6:30pm 

Starting October 4 

Women's Center Small Conference Room 

 

The Coming Out group is a place to meet and gain support while discussing your sexual and/or gender Identities in a confidential setting.  This group is for lesbian, gay, bisexual, transgender, straight, or questioning folks who are coming out, considering coming out or may already be out.  Topics are determined by group participants and can include stress, fear, anxiety, loneliness, excitement and celebration with regard to coming out.
